Know the role of federation of Indian export organizations

There are many organizations and agencies in India that give various sorts of help to exporters regularly. These export organizations do market research in overseas commerce and disseminate information from their research and market surveys. As a result, the exporter should contact them for help. 


The Federation of Indian Export Organizations is the umbrella organization for different export promotion organizations and institutes in India. It was founded in 1965 and had its registered office in Delhi. Federation of Indian export organizations serves as a common and coordinating platform for diverse export organizations, such as commodity councils and boards and service institutions and organizations. 

FIEO's main operations 




The Foreign Trade Policy of the Government of India and the Memorandum and Articles of Association of FIEO govern the membership rules of the organization. To reap the foreign trade policy benefits, an exporter must get the Registration- cum –Membership Certificate (RCMC). For registration reasons, the government has recognized FIEO as an Export Promotion Council. 


The government has designated Federation of Indian export organizations as an Export Promotion Council. According to the Foreign Trade Policy, an exporter must get a Registration-cum-Membership Certificate (RCMC) to take advantage of the Policy's numerous benefits. If multi-product exporters are not registered with any EPC and who’s main line of business has still to be determined, the exporter must get RCMC from the Federation of Indian Exporters Organization (FIEO).

The following are the main activities carried out by FIEO: 


1. Organizing meetings, conferences, seminars, and workshops to evaluate and debate India's export challenges and opportunities. It formulates and authorizes recommendations to the government. India's exporting communities and export promotion institutes are represented in the meetings and seminars' deliberations. 


2. The FIEO organizes round table meetings of business interests with trade delegations and other business teams visiting India. 


3. Inviting Economic and Trade Missions from other countries to visit India's industrial and commercial centers. 


4. Organizing media events, exhibits, advertising, and publications to showcase Indian goods and services in international markets. 


5. FIEO funds trade and economic missions, export houses, consulting businesses, and study sales teams. 


6. Maintaining contact with international organizations such as the International Trade Centre (ITC), the World Trade Organization (WTO), the United Nations Conference on Trade and Development (UNCTAD), the Economic and Social Commission for Asia and the Pacific (ESCAP), the United Nations Industrial Development Organization (UNIDO), the International Monetary Fund (IMF), the World Bank, and the International Labor Organization (ILO), among others. 


7. FIEO maintains communication with foreign chambers of business, trade groups, and relevant government offices. 


8. FIEO sponsors specific initiatives linked to the marketing of India's consulting services for export. 


9. The FIEO acts as a platform for two-way communication between government agencies and the exporting community. 


10. Using international seminars to promote commercial, economic, and technological cooperation between India and other countries. 


Federation of Indian export organizations conducts export studies and research to assist states in identifying prospective export items and developing strategies to facilitate exports of such products. FIEO publishes a monthly bulletin called FIEO News and has recently launched a weekly e-newsletter called INTRADE, which keeps exporters up to date on worldwide happenings influencing international trade and information about the country's foreign trade.
